This position has organizational impact by supporting partnerships with current employers and developing relationships with new employers to increase ECEs (Enriched Career Experiences) and employment opportunities. This position will also, engage and partner with alumni and other stakeholders for ECEs, Cranberry Investment internships and employment opportunities.

Specific responsibilities include:
  •  Working in a team-based department to execute Career Development and Success (CDS) employer relations strategies, objectives and initiatives with a specific focus on liberal arts and science majors in the College of Arts and Sciences (CAS).
  • Serve as a liaison between the University and employers. 
  • Maximize student employment outcomes by expanding Enriched Career Experiences -ECE (internships, co-ops, fieldwork, research, scholarship, arts, media & creative productions) and employment opportunities. 

Position Requirements

  •  A Bachelor’s degree along with 2-3 years of work experience in a corporate/industry or university career services setting. 
  • Demonstrated ability to create and maintain partnerships
  • Demonstrated professionalism. 
  • Demonstrated exceptional organization, written, time management, and presentation skills.
  • Demonstrated overall knowledge of science disciplines and professional fields.
  • Demonstrated ability to exercise independent judgment and to work independently in a team environment
  • Demonstrated ability to be flexible with local travel (required)
  • Car and an in good standing driver’s license are required. 
  • Demonstrated ability to work evenings and weekends as required.
